Output 183894efb225cf4f9cdfbd199f53cd165146a7ec9827ba5a3cd473c63bb3bd91:3

value
988919566
script pubkey
OP_0 OP_PUSHBYTES_20 b0655e984e79c0c5bf71ba223e653b5f04175394
address
tb1qkpj4axzw08qvt0m3hg3ruefmtuzpw5u5jhkkgh
transaction
183894efb225cf4f9cdfbd199f53cd165146a7ec9827ba5a3cd473c63bb3bd91
confirmations
132849
spent
true